English Translation

Anas (may Allah be pleased with him) reported that Allah's Messenger ﷺ took an oath that he would not visit his wives for one month, and he sat in an upper room belonging to him. Then, on the twenty ninth day he came down. It was said, "O Allah's Messenger ﷺ! You had taken an oath not to visit your wives for one month." He said, "The (present) month is of twenty-nine days
